Tomorrow 3
Tomorrow 3

Woke up yesterday to find it was tomorrow;
some other today I might have to borrow,
for mine was lost somewhere in limbo,
my calendar completely thrown akimbo.

My list of tasks was a matter of sorrow,
all those things I’d put off until the morrow
stared back at me, their moment come;
once promised, I must pay the sum.

I began to work and soon the sweat
upon my brow stood cold and wet,
throughout the day I laboured long,
late in the night I finished the throng.

Exhausted then, on the bed I fell
sleep descended, how fast I cannot tell,
and in the morning, to my relief unbound,
today had returned and now it’s found.
